Understanding Newsmax's Market Position

Before we jump into predicting the IPO price, it's super important to understand where Newsmax stands in the media landscape. Newsmax Media, Inc. has carved out a significant niche, particularly among conservative viewers. This positioning is both a strength and a challenge when it comes to valuation. Here’s why:

  • Target Audience: Newsmax caters to a specific demographic, which provides a loyal viewer base. This loyalty can translate into consistent revenue streams, which investors love.
  • Competition: The media industry is fiercely competitive. Newsmax faces competition from established giants like Fox News, as well as numerous online news platforms. Standing out and continuing to grow viewership is crucial.
  • Market Trends: The shift towards digital media consumption is undeniable. Newsmax needs to demonstrate a strong strategy for capturing and retaining audiences across various platforms, including streaming and social media.

Newsmax's ability to leverage its niche audience, navigate the competitive landscape, and adapt to changing media trends will significantly impact its IPO valuation. Investors will be looking closely at these factors when deciding whether to invest.

Factors Influencing the IPO Price

Okay, so what actually goes into figuring out the IPO price? It's not just pulling a number out of thin air! Several key factors play a crucial role in determining how much Newsmax shares will be worth when they first hit the market. Let's break them down:

  1. Financial Performance: This is a big one. Investors will scrutinize Newsmax's revenue, profitability, and growth rate. Consistent revenue growth and a clear path to profitability are huge selling points. If Newsmax can show that they're making money and have a plan to make even more, that's a win.
  2. Market Conditions: The overall health of the stock market and investor sentiment can significantly impact IPO valuations. A bull market (when stock prices are rising) generally leads to higher valuations, while a bear market (when prices are falling) can dampen enthusiasm. Basically, if the market's doing well, Newsmax has a better chance of a successful IPO.
  3. Comparable Companies: Investment bankers will look at how similar companies in the media industry are valued. This involves analyzing metrics like price-to-earnings (P/E) ratios and price-to-sales (P/S) ratios. If other media companies are trading at high multiples, it could suggest a higher valuation for Newsmax.
  4. Growth Potential: Investors are always looking for growth. Newsmax needs to articulate a compelling vision for the future, including plans for expanding its audience, launching new products, and increasing revenue. The more potential for growth, the more attractive the IPO becomes.
  5. Use of Proceeds: How Newsmax plans to use the money raised from the IPO is also important. If the company intends to invest in growth initiatives, such as expanding its digital presence or acquiring other businesses, that can be viewed positively. However, if the money is primarily used to pay off debt, investors may be less enthusiastic.

Risks and Challenges

Of course, investing in an IPO always comes with risks. It's not all sunshine and rainbows! Here are some potential challenges that Newsmax investors should be aware of:

  • Market Volatility: Stock prices can be unpredictable, especially in the short term. Market downturns or unexpected events could negatively impact Newsmax's stock price.
  • Competition: The media industry is highly competitive. Newsmax faces intense competition from established players and emerging online platforms.
  • Changing Media Landscape: The media industry is constantly evolving. Newsmax needs to adapt to changing consumer preferences and technological advancements.
  • Political and Social Factors: Newsmax's political positioning could attract both supporters and detractors, potentially impacting its brand image and financial performance.

How to Invest in the Newsmax IPO

Interested in potentially getting in on the Newsmax IPO? Here's a general guide on how IPOs usually work. (Keep in mind that I can't give financial advice; this is just for informational purposes!)

  1. Find a Brokerage Account: You'll need a brokerage account to buy stocks. Many online brokers offer access to IPOs.
  2. Check IPO Eligibility: Not all brokerage accounts offer access to every IPO. Check with your broker to see if they will be participating in the Newsmax IPO.
  3. Express Interest: If your broker is participating, you can usually express interest in buying shares. This doesn't guarantee you'll get them, but it puts you in the running.
  4. Review the Prospectus: Before investing, read the IPO prospectus carefully. This document contains important information about the company, its financials, and the risks involved.
  5. Place Your Order: If you decide to invest, place your order through your brokerage account. Keep in mind that demand for IPO shares can be high, so you may not get all the shares you requested.
